发表于: 2018-04-08 20:38:56

1 564


今天完成的事情:

      完成了任务2的,但是还没有使用REST风格接口

.这些,下面我详细讲讲 任务的JAVAWEB如何实现



1.首先使用IDEA  new  一个新的MAVEN webapp项目,目录最好规范

目录结构

在pom中添加

以下依赖,也就是Jar包.


然后其他的创建和任务的Spring+mybatis一样..包含 model,dao,service(包含seviceImpl).

SSM web项目中多了 controller多了这里


springmvc.xml的配置

作用个人理解主要是把controller 和 views下的 jsp 页面进行交互..

web.xml

个人理解就相当  网页  和  代码 之间的桥梁,所有的东西都要通过它加载的各种xml文件与它的监听类,才能实现网页与代码的互通


controller类  首先 我们得在类名上面加上 @Controller 标注明白他是一个 controller类,供我们的springmvc.xml进行扫描,使它和和mvc 中的c 相通


@ResqusetMapping(vlaue="??") 在方法名上进行标注,表明 网页要执行这个方法,就得通过访问??来实现该方法.


ModelAndView  翻译大概是模型和视图,   我们把 模型 也就是实体类放入该 modelandview.addObjet该种,表明我们在网页需要操作的东西就是 ,该实体类里面的...             modelandview.setViewName (???)表明 把该方法 显示到 ??? 的 网页端 上


???的位置,就是在springmvc.xml中的配置的  位置在views下面,后缀名为jsp格式.


当我们只调用方法的时候 ,不是ModelAndView 也可以显示在 网页上,但是显示出来的就是一串字符串.所以我们就得了解一下大概的jsp 的标签.

明天的计划:

       改进我的SSM项目,让他通过 Restful风格实现.

遇到的问题:

       不明白的时候难的不知道问题出在哪,明白了以后出现问题爆什么错,就大概知道是哪里的问题了.





返回列表 返回列表
评论

    分享到